
Avoid Makeup. You heard us right! Even if you’re one of those women who never leaves the house without makeup, we promise that this small sacrifice can do wonders for your skin! At the least, avoid foundations and powders while traveling, as these products can dry out your face. Instead, try a tinted moisturizer or just stick with a little bit of cream blush for your cheeks.
Apply Facial Oil. No matter your skin type, facial oil can combat that dry skin you suffer from when traveling. For optimal results, apply this oil every hour or so on the plane to avoid loss of moisture from the change in altitude.
Drink water. We know that drinking water is wonderful for your skin (and your overall health). But when you're traveling for the holidays, be sure to drink more than you typically would and avoid excessive amounts of alcohol. Your skin will thank you later!
Sunscreen. Going somewhere tropical? If so, be careful when being exposed to the sun, as UV rays can penetrate and damage even the deepest layers of your skin. Sunscreen is your best defense against sunburn for the holidays.
